https://callback.58.com/antibot/verifycode?serialId=282ab8a51a3585cd3929770e2db0ff5f_d9ab8cc1e690428d8483eeebcada9d96&code=100&sign=50772948888a92807bc3353f9e36192a&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Ffangchenggang.anjuke.com%2Fsale%2Fdongxings%2Fb14004-l7-m11183-y4-z5-fl5-ls1